Plum Cake with a Twist

bakingwithnessa
A little bit of Meyer Lemon Oil sprinkled over the cake with a dash of sugar will create a nice twist to this timeless cake.

Prep Time 15 minutes
Bake / Cook Time 30 minutes
Total Time 45 minutes
Course Dessert
Cuisine French
Servings 6

Ingredients
 

  • 2 (5) plums
  • 3 oz (85 g) butter (Melted)
  • 3 eggs
  • 3 oz (85 g) sugar
  • 3 tbsp (29.57 g) heavy whipping cream
  • 1 tsp vanilla extract
  • 5 oz (140 g) flour (sifted)
  • 1.5 tsp (6 g) baking powder
  • 1 tbsp Meyer Lemon Oil
  • 1 tsp sugar

Instructions
 

  • Preheat oven at 350F/180C.
  • Wash and thinly slice your plums. Set aside.
  • Place butter in a small sauce pan and heat on low until melted. Set aside.
  • In a mixing bowl, whisk together eggs and sugar,
  • Add the heavy whipping cream, vanilla extract and melted butter.
  • Finish by adding the flour and baking powder.
  • On your workstation, place the perforated baking sheet and the Flexipan® on top.
  • With the help of the spatula, pour your batter into the Flexipan®.
  • Add the sliced plums by gently pushing them down. Sprinkle with the Meyer Lemon Oil and sugar.
  • Bake for 30 minutes at 350F/180C. (Every oven heats differently, monitor your cake from 20min)
  • Once your cake is out of the oven, let it completely cool down before unmolding. Then, Serve and Enjoy! Bon Appétit!
